The Director, BD & Capture is a strategic relationship and brand builder responsible for identifying, cultivating, and advancing customer relationships that drive new business growth. This leader thrives in fast-paced, high-growth environments, adapting quickly to changing priorities and emerging opportunities. Self-motivated and confident, the Director combines creativity with disciplined capture execution and clear communication of complex technical solutions.
Strategy- Think above and beyond the day-to-day responsibilities to understand broader growth strategy
- Apply understanding of the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) and industry best practices
- Understand overall government and individual agency vehicle / acquisition methods and strategically build partnerships, contractor teaming arrangements, and other strategic alliances
- Understand company quarterly and annual revenue targets and develop the account strategy to meet them
Own and drive the full spectrum of business development, capture, and proposal activities — from initial qualification through award. Proven track record of closing new business.
- Define entry strategy into target agencies or accounts. Align opportunity pursuit with company strategy.
- Perform account, partner, and opportunity research.
- Maintain pipeline of qualified opportunities across accounts (Department of War, Department of Homeland Security, Health and Human Services, and vehicles (OASIS+, Polaris, SEWP, etc.))
- Develop call plans for key decision-makers; track outcomes and next steps in CRM. Demonstrate early shaping and influence.
- Execute call plan; build trusted relationships, gather intel.
- Form strategic alliances, JVs, and CTAs aligned with opportunity scope, set-asides, and past performance needs.
- Identify incumbent strengths/weaknesses, likely pricing strategy, key personnel, and teaming configurations.
- Translate technical concepts, hot buttons, and win strategies into white papers, market research, and proposal writing.
- Participate in seminars, conferences, and forums; engage in industry associations/groups to increase brand awareness.
- 7–10 years of experience leading federal business development, pipeline strategy, and capture management from opportunity identification through award within multi-agency portfolios.
- Demonstrated ability to deliver $25M+ in new business over a 2-year period.
- Experience managing pipelines across contract vehicles and schedules (OASIS preferred, MAS) and tracking task order opportunities.
- Experience building and leading high-performing BD/capture teams in a matrixed environment. Relentless focus on pipeline conversion, win rates, and exceeding growth targets.
- Experience building and winning pipelines in DHS, DoW, and other civilian (GSA, NASA) agencies strongly preferred.
- Maintains existing network of customer contacts in National Security, Department of War, and Civilian communities.
- Proven record of full and open (F&O) contract awards desired.
- Must have experience with federal proposals and understand complex RFQ/RFP compliance requirements.
- Active and visible presence in professional associations (ACT-IAC, GTSC, AFCEA, etc.); leadership roles or speaking engagements strongly preferred.
- Bachelor’s Degree in technical, business, or related discipline.
